How to File for Unemployment Insurance Benefits Online

Filing for unemployment insurance online cuts out the hassle of waiting on the phone and talking to an automated voice directory system. Follow these steps to file your unemployment claim online.

Instructions

    • 1

      Locate your state's unemployment insurance website address.
      The exact address will vary by state, but you can contact the employment security department if you are not sure how to find the website.

    • 2

      Gather all personal information that will be required to file for unemployment online.
      Your social security number, date of birth, address, military and citizenship status will all be required to fill out an unemployment benefit application.

    • 3

      Enter information about your last employer into the application form.
      You will need the name of the employer, their address, your wages, and dates of employment.

    • 4

      Indicate whether or not you would like your unemployment insurance to be withheld for taxes.
      If you don't choose to withhold, you will likely have to pay into taxes around tax time.

    • 5

      Agree to the terms and laws by which you are permitted to apply for unemployment by electronically signing the unemployment application.
